Transaction 863241a7364768941c26da453ad322a87cc468cacf43c9bee71658fad8f585f7

2 Input
2 Outputs
  • 863241a7364768941c26da453ad322a87cc468cacf43c9bee71658fad8f585f7:0
  • value  6890625
    address  1MpcmD3HUAAAvEYBCB181sbQjEfvK2NjfJ
  • 863241a7364768941c26da453ad322a87cc468cacf43c9bee71658fad8f585f7:1
  • value  1839197
    address  1Btc2UrZTqcbjLrr8trx66K9TozQmKeDGN